37 * Create an ELF descriptor for a memory image, optionally reporting
38 * parse errors.
41 Elf *
42 _libelf_memory(unsigned char *image, size_t sz, int reporterror)
44 Elf *e;
45 int e_class;
46 enum Elf_Error error;
47 unsigned int e_byteorder, e_version;
49 assert(image != NULL);
50 assert(sz > 0);
52 if ((e = _libelf_allocate_elf()) == NULL)
53 return (NULL);
55 e->e_cmd = ELF_C_READ;
56 e->e_rawfile = image;
57 e->e_rawsize = sz;
59 #undef LIBELF_IS_ELF
60 #define LIBELF_IS_ELF(P) ((P)[EI_MAG0] == ELFMAG0 && \
61 (P)[EI_MAG1] == ELFMAG1 && (P)[EI_MAG2] == ELFMAG2 && \
62 (P)[EI_MAG3] == ELFMAG3)
64 if (sz > EI_NIDENT && LIBELF_IS_ELF(image)) {
65 e_byteorder = image[EI_DATA];
66 e_class = image[EI_CLASS];
67 e_version = image[EI_VERSION];
69 error = ELF_E_NONE;
71 if (e_version > EV_CURRENT)
72 error = ELF_E_VERSION;
73 else if ((e_byteorder != ELFDATA2LSB && e_byteorder !=
74 ELFDATA2MSB) || (e_class != ELFCLASS32 && e_class !=
75 ELFCLASS64))
76 error = ELF_E_HEADER;
78 if (error != ELF_E_NONE) {
79 if (reporterror) {
80 LIBELF_PRIVATE(error) = LIBELF_ERROR(error, 0);
81 (void) _libelf_release_elf(e);
82 return (NULL);
84 } else {
85 _libelf_init_elf(e, ELF_K_ELF);
87 e->e_byteorder = e_byteorder;
88 e->e_class = e_class;
89 e->e_version = e_version;
91 } else if (sz >= SARMAG &&
92 strncmp((const char *) image, ARMAG, (size_t) SARMAG) == 0)
93 return (_libelf_ar_open(e, reporterror));
95 return (e);
